Default Today's waivers: Pirri (VGK), Colborne (COL), Wiercioch (VAN)

@reporterchris
On NHL waivers today: Brandon Pirri (VGK), Chandler Stephenson (Wash), Joe Colborne (Col), Eric Tangradi (Det), Patrick Wiercioch (Van).
